State Departments of Transportation (DOTs) are continually assessing and choosing materials or technologies to meet their transportation needs. As part of this assessment, DOTs are turning to Environmental Product Declarations (EPDs) to quantify the environmental impacts associated with those products.

Traffic Volume Trends is a monthly report based on hourly traffic count data reported by the States. These data are collected at approximately 5,000 continuous traffic counting locations nationwide and are used to estimate the percent change in traffic for the current month compared with the same month in the previous year. High friction surface treatment (HFST) is a safety-first pavement treatment intended to restore and maintain pavement friction to reduce crashes. The cost of HFST is high compared to typical maintenance treatments; however, HFST is highly effective at reducing wet-weather and run-off road crashes.
